Suppose you had two circular objects. Let the first circular object have a diameter of 26 cm and let second circular object have a diameter that is half as long as the diameter of the first. What would the circumference be for the second item in centimeters?

1 Answer

3 votes

Answer:

40.82cm

Explanation:

half of 26 is 13

the second's circle diameter is 13

the formula for circumference is C = 2πr

where r is the radius and π is 3.14

diameter =2r

13 = 2r

r = 6.5

2 x 6.5 x 3.14 = 40.82

40.82 cm
